首页 »标签 » count是什么函数 » 列表
2008年9月25日count函数:C++函数对象count_if
标准库里的count_if可以统计容器中满足特定条件的元素的个数。例如要统计一个整数vector——ivec中正数的个数,可以先写一个返回类型为bool,含有一个int参数的条件函数:
参考:[http://www.CrazyCoder.cn/]()( ...
[阅读全文] [PDF]
2008年9月25日count函数:C++函数对象count_if
标准库里的count_if可以统计容器中满足特定条件的元素的个数。例如要统计一个整数vector——ivec中正数的个数,可以先写一个返回类型为bool,含有一个int参数的条件函数:boolpred(intval)...{ returnval>0; } 之后可以用count_if(ivec.begin(),ivec.end(),pred)计算出正整数的个数。但这个方法有一个明显的缺陷:如果要统计大于10的个数、大于100的个数……就要写很多个类似的函数,能不能进一步抽象?如果能像这样调用count_if:count_if(ivec.begin(),ivec....
[阅读全文] [PDF]
1 共2条 分1页